Subject: [PATCH v3 1/2] virtio_net: disable VIRTIO_NET_F_STANDBY if VIRTIO_NET_F_MAC is not set

failover relies on the MAC address to pair the primary and the standby
devices:

  "[...] the hypervisor needs to enable VIRTIO_NET_F_STANDBY
   feature on the virtio-net interface and assign the same MAC address
   to both virtio-net and VF interfaces."

  Documentation/networking/net_failover.rst

This patch disables the STANDBY feature if the MAC address is not
provided by the hypervisor.

Signed-off-by: Laurent Vivier <lvivier@redhat.com>
---
 drivers/net/virtio_net.c | 6 ++++++
 1 file changed, 6 insertions(+)

diff --git a/drivers/net/virtio_net.c b/drivers/net/virtio_net.c
index 7723b2a49d8e..7d700f8e545a 100644
--- a/drivers/net/virtio_net.c
+++ b/drivers/net/virtio_net.c
@@ -3688,6 +3688,12 @@ static int virtnet_validate(struct virtio_device *vdev)
 			__virtio_clear_bit(vdev, VIRTIO_NET_F_MTU);
 	}
 
+	if (virtio_has_feature(vdev, VIRTIO_NET_F_STANDBY) &&
+	    !virtio_has_feature(vdev, VIRTIO_NET_F_MAC)) {
+		dev_warn(&vdev->dev, "device advertises feature VIRTIO_NET_F_STANDBY but not VIRTIO_NET_F_MAC, disabling standby");
+		__virtio_clear_bit(vdev, VIRTIO_NET_F_STANDBY);
+	}
+
 	return 0;
 }
